Cahir (The black knight in the feathered helm) is a character in The Witcher, part of Cintra & Nilfgaard. Cahir Mawr Dyffryn aep Ceallach leads Nilfgaard's hunt for the princess of Cintra — the black knight with the winged helmet who burns through the north with a believer's calm. He serves the White Flame with total conviction and pursues Ciri across battlefields and burning cities like a man executing scripture. To Ciri he is the nightmare with feathers. To Nilfgaard he is devotion, weaponized.

When does Cahir first appear?

Cahir first appears in Season 1, Episode 1 (“The End's Beginning”) of The Witcher (2019–, Netflix).
